TL;DR Summary

The superintendent of Des Moines Public Schools, Ian Roberts, was detained by ICE due to being in the country illegally from Guyana, possessing a final order of removal, and found with a loaded handgun, a hunting knife, and cash. Roberts, who joined the district in 2023 and has a 20-year educational background, is currently under investigation, with the school district uncertain about next steps.
